South Korea Veterinary Ultrasound Market Report 2026

The South Korea veterinary ultrasound market is a rapidly growing sector, valued at approximately USD 9.5 million in 2023 and projected to reach USD 15.8 million by 2030. This expansion is driven by a steady compound annual growth rate of 7.4%, supported by a robust healthcare infrastructure and an increasing focus on advanced diagnostic imaging for companion animals. The market landscape is characterized by a high adoption of equipment, which accounted for a significant revenue share of nearly 59% in 2023, while Picture Archiving and Communication Systems (PACS) are emerging as the most lucrative and fastest-growing solution segment. Strategic collaborations, such as the 2026 partnership between Samsung Medison and the Korean Veterinary Medical Association, further illustrate the industry’s shift toward enhancing imaging standards and integrating innovative technologies. While established global players like IDEXX, Fujifilm, and Canon dominate the competitive arena, the market remains highly dynamic with rising investments in specialized areas like animal reproductive ultrasound and the humanization of pets driving demand for early disease detection. Despite challenges such as high equipment costs and a shortage of trained professionals, the market is poised for continued transformation through the integration of artificial intelligence for automated workflows and the increasing use of portable, point-of-care systems.

Key Drivers, Restraints, Opportunities, and Challenges in the South Korea Veterinary Ultrasound Market

The South Korea veterinary ultrasound market is primarily driven by expanding pet ownership, the rapid aging of the pet population, and increasing expenditure on advanced animal healthcare and diagnostic procedures. Significant opportunities exist in the development of digital solutions, the integration of artificial intelligence for enhanced imaging, and the expansion of remote consultation and cloud-sharing services for veterinary workflows. However, the market faces notable restraints, including the high initial capital investment required for advanced ultrasound systems and ongoing maintenance costs, which can limit adoption among smaller, independent practices. Furthermore, a critical challenge remains the shortage of skilled professionals capable of accurately interpreting complex imaging results, particularly in specialized areas like Doppler ultrasound, necessitating continuous education and professional training to improve diagnostic accuracy and market penetration.

Technological Innovations and Disruption Potential in the South Korea Veterinary Ultrasound Market

Technological innovations such as the integration of artificial intelligence (AI) and machine learning are significantly disrupting the South Korea veterinary ultrasound market by enhancing diagnostic accuracy and streamlining workflows through automated image analysis. AI-powered solutions, like SK Telecom’s X Caliber and various diagnostic assistance apps, are gaining traction by enabling rapid disease detection and addressing veterinarian shortages. Furthermore, the development of portable, handheld, and wireless ultrasound devices is decentralizing animal healthcare, allowing for real-time, non-invasive diagnostics in diverse settings ranging from general practices to field sites. Other emerging disruptions include the advancement of high-intensity focused ultrasound (HIFU) for therapeutic applications, the adoption of 3D/4D and Doppler imaging for complex visualizations, and the rise of cloud-connected systems for tele-ultrasound consultations.
